W = boiler capacity (Btu/h, kW) h g = enthalpy steam (Btu/lb, kJ/kg) h f = enthalpy condensate (Btu/lb, kJ/kg) m = steam evaporated (lb/h, kg/s) Boiler Horsepower - BHP. The Boiler Horsepower (BHP) is. the amount of energy required to produce 34.5 pounds of steam per hour at a pressure and temperature of 0 Psig and 212 o F, with feedwater at 0 Learn More

How to convert megawatts to boiler horsepower [MW to BHP]:. P BHP = 101.931042 × P MW. How many boiler horsepower in a megawatt: If P MW = 1 then P BHP = 101.931042 × 1 = 101.931042 BHP. How many boiler horsepower in 56 megawatts: If P MW = 56 then P BHP = 101.931042 × 56 = 5 708.138352 BHP. Note: Megawatt is a metric unit of power.Boiler …Learn More

The trend in fossil-fuelled power stations is towards larger and larger power station units (> 1000 MW in 2011). This has led to boiler feed pumps with a drive rating of 30 - 50 MW. Until 1950, the average pressure in the outlet cross-section of the pump (discharge pressure of the feed pump) was in the 200 bar region.Learn More

Heat Rates The Williams Lake plant also holds the distinction of having the largest single boiler (60 MW) and the lowest heat rate (11,700 Btu/kWh) of any biomass-fired power plant. boilers.1 Five major steam-intensive industries are host to most of the industrial boilers. Food, paper, chemicals, refining and primary metals have 71 percent of the boiler units and 82 percent of the boiler capacity. The chemicals industry has more boilers (12,000) and capacity (413,000 MMBtu/hr) than any other industry. The paper industry has aLearn More

The upper steam capacity of fire tube boilers is about 20,000 Ibm/hr, and the peak pressure obtainable is limited by their large shells to about 300 psi. Fire-tube boilers are used for heating systems. ME 416/516 Cleaver-Brooks Horizontal, four-pass, forced-draft fire-tube boiler.Learn More
